QQ咨询不加好友发不了信息,咨询前先加好友! → QQ:820896380 ×

深入探讨Linux ext2文件系统的物理存储结构

深入探讨linux ext2文件系统的物理存储结构

Linux ext2文件系统是一种在大部分Linux操作系统上使用的文件系统,它采用了一种高效的磁盘存储结构来管理文件和目录的存储。在深入探讨Linux ext2文件系统的物理存储结构之前,我们首先需要了解一些基本概念。

在ext2文件系统中,数据存储在数据块(block)中,数据块是文件系统中最小的可分配单位。每个数据块有固定的大小,通常为1KB、2KB或4KB。文件系统还将磁盘上的数据块划分为组(group),每个组包含若干个数据块,并由一个组描述符(group descriptor)来描述。

每个组都有一个组描述符,组描述符包含一些重要的信息,比如组中有多少个数据块、索引节点(inode)的起始位置等。索引节点是ext2文件系统中用来描述文件和目录属性的数据结构。

接下来我们来深入探讨Linux ext2文件系统的物理存储结构,并附上一些代码示例以帮助更好地理解。

首先,我们需要打开一个Linux终端,并使用以下命令来创建一个新的ext2文件系统:

mkfs.ext2 /dev/sda1

给TA打赏
共{{data.count}}人
人已打赏
运维

linux可以删除存储硬盘吗

2024-5-17 10:48:40

运维

如何在Linux上使用Docker进行容器的快速备份和恢复?

2024-5-17 10:51:43

个人中心
购物车
优惠劵
有新私信 私信列表
搜索